DirecTV Acquisition Termination: DirecTV will end its planned acquisition of Dish TV after bondholders rejected a necessary debt swap for the deal.
Deadline for Agreement: The satellite TV provider had set a deadline of November 22 to finalize the acquisition, contingent on bondholder approval of the debt exchange.
